So, 'Travelling Salesman' is this intriguing piece that dives deep into the world of mathematics, you know? It's not just about the numbers; it really builds a palpable tension as four mathematicians gather with a government official. The atmosphere is thick with suspicion and moral dilemmas, which makes for a pretty compelling watch. The pacing? It's deliberate, almost like a chess match, where you feel every move counts. The performances might not be flashy, but they nail the awkwardness and intensity of the situation. It's distinctive because it plays on the ethical implications of their discovery, not just the discovery itself. Definitely a cerebral experience that lingers long after the credits roll.
